1. **Technical SEO for Affiliate Blogs**
Ensure your affiliate blog is technically sound by:
* Conducting regular site audits using tools like Screaming Frog or Ahrefs to identify areas for improvement
* Optimizing page titles, meta descriptions, and header tags to increase crawlability and indexing
* Implementing schema markup to enhance search engine rankings and provide users with valuable information
For example, a popular affiliate blog in the SaaS space optimized its product pages by adding schema markup, which resulted in a 25% increase in organic traffic.
2. **Content Creation and Pillar Page Strategy**
Develop high-quality, informative content that addresses specific pain points for your target audience. Create pillar pages – comprehensive guides or resources that dive deep into a particular topic – to attract and engage users.
Utilize tools like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ush to identify relevant keywords and create detailed guides that cater to those topics. This approach not only enhances user experience but also increases the chances of ranking higher in search engine results pages (SERPs).

Targeted Long-Tail Keywords
Instead of targeting broad keywords like “affordable software solutions,” focus on long-tail keywords like “best project management tools for small businesses” or “affordable CRM systems with 24/7 support.” This approach allows you to target specific pain points and interests, increasing the chances of converting users.
For example, HubSpot’s blog ranks high for long-tail keywords like “inbound marketing strategies for small businesses,” driving significant traffic and conversions. By targeting specific phrases, SaaS teams can attract highly targeted audiences and increase their conversion rates.

**Heatmap Analysis**
One effective way to understand user behavior is through heatmap analysis. Heatmaps provide a visual representation of which areas of your content receive the most attention from users. This can be achieved using tools like Crazy Egg or Hotjar. By analyzing heatmaps, you can identify:
* Which elements of your content (e.g., images, calls-to-action) are more prominent to users
* Which sections of your content are causing users to abandon their journey (e.g., too much information or lack of clear next steps)
For example, let’s say we’re optimizing an affiliate blog post for a SaaS tool. We conduct heatmap analysis and find that the section with the most heat is a specific paragraph highlighting the benefits of using the tool. We then update the paragraph to make it more concise and visually appealing.
**A/B Testing**
A/B testing involves comparing two versions of your content to determine which one performs better in terms of conversion rates. This can be done for everything from button text to image sources.
For instance, we might want to test the following:
* Button text: “Start Your Free Trial” vs. “Try it Risk-Free”
* Image source: A logo highlighting the benefits of the SaaS tool or a generic stock image
We use tools like OptinMonster or Unbounce to run A/B tests and analyze results. This helps us identify which variations perform better, allowing us to optimize our content for maximum conversion rates.

2. Use Schema Markup to Enhance CTR
Schema markup is a microdata format that provides search engines with additional context about content, such as reviews, events, and organizations. By adding schema markup to affiliate blog posts, SaaS teams can increase click-through rates (CTR) on SERP results. For example, adding schema markup for product reviews can help users find more relevant information when searching for products.

Using Keyword Clustering
1. Group similar keywords together and analyze their performance using keyword clustering tools like Ahrefs or SEMrush.
2. Identify top-performing keywords within each cluster and prioritize them in your content strategy.
3. Use this approach to create a comprehensive keyword map that guides content creation.
Example of a successful keyword cluster:
* Primary keyword: “project management”
* Secondary keywords:
+ “best project management software”
+ “project management tools”
+ “project planning templates”
